Output 21464787048bab73723e95396465a8bfa303084f143a28345abbc74777a0e3fe:1

value
21714760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25f26853e382af51a2712ad1deec8b11c266840 OP_EQUAL
address
3LsMozt2MJKwpozBKiF8bYxFqJUMRo9f5f
transaction
21464787048bab73723e95396465a8bfa303084f143a28345abbc74777a0e3fe
spent
true